About UNIQLO and Fast Retailing UNIQLO is a brand of Fast Retailing Co., Ltd., a leading Japanese retail holding company with global headquarters in Tokyo, Japan. UNIQLO is the largest of eight brands in the Fast Retailing Group, the others being GU, Theory, PLST, Comptoir des Cotonniers, Princesse tam.tam, J Brand and Helmut Lang. With global sales of approximately 2.77 trillion yen for the 2023 fiscal year ending August 31, 2023 (US $18.92 billion, calculated in yen using the end of August 2023 rate of $1 = 146.2 yen), Fast Retailing is one of the world’s largest apparel retail companies, and UNIQLO is Japan’s leading specialty retailer. UNIQLO continues to open large-scale stores in some of the world's most important cities and locations, as part of its ongoing efforts to solidify its status as a global brand. Today the company has a total of more than 2,400 UNIQLO stores across the world, including Japan, Asia, Europe, and North America. The total number of stores across Fast Retailing's brands is now close to 3,600.

In Zephyr's userspace dynamic-objects subsystem, thread_idx_alloc() in kernel/userspace/userspace.c allocated a new thread permission index from the global _thread_idx_map[] bitmap without holding lists_lock. On SMP systems, two user-mode threads invoking the k_object_alloc(K_OBJ_THREAD) syscall concurrently can both observe the same low free bit, perform the same non-atomic RMW to clear it, and return the identical tidx. The two newly created K_OBJ_THREAD objects are then assigned the same thread_id, so the two user threads alias a single bit position in every kernel object's perms[] bitfield: any subsequent grant of access on a kernel object to one thread is implicitly a grant to the other, defeating userspace ACL isolation. A secondary lost-update window between the unlocked &=~BIT() in alloc and the locked |= BIT() in thread_idx_free() can also leak entries from the thread-index pool. The defect is reachable from any user-mode thread via the unrestricted __syscall k_object_alloc and is gated on CONFIG_USERSPACE, CONFIG_DYNAMIC_OBJECTS, and CONFIG_SMP. The flaw was introduced when the per-thread permission index was added in 2018 and is present in every release up to and including v4.4.0. Fixed by holding lists_lock across the bitmap RMW and the permissions clear (and inlining the obj_list traversal that previously took the lock itself).
OpenRemote before 1.26.2 contains an authentication bypass vulnerability in the console registration API that allows unauthenticated attackers to update existing console assets by supplying a known asset identifier. Attackers can overwrite push notification tokens and console metadata without authentication or ownership validation, redirecting notifications or denying delivery to legitimate consoles.
SiYuan before v3.7.2 contains a missing authorization vulnerability in the POST /mcp kernel endpoint, which is gated only by a general auth check (model.CheckAuth) with no admin-role or read-only enforcement. This exposes 31 MCP tools, including a file tool with list/read/write/delete/rename/copy actions across the entire workspace. When the Publish server is enabled in anonymous mode (Conf.Publish.Enable=true and Conf.Publish.Auth.Enable=false), the Publish reverse proxy attaches an anonymous RoleReader JWT to proxied requests, allowing a remote unauthenticated attacker to reach /mcp. The attacker can read conf/conf.json to extract accessAuthCode, api.token, and cookieKey in plaintext, write arbitrary files in the workspace, and plant a plugin into data/plugins/ that executes with nodeIntegration:true and no contextIsolation on the next desktop launch, leading to administrator takeover.

In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: crypto: qat - remove unused character device and IOCTLs The QAT driver exposes a character device (qat_adf_ctl) with IOCTLs for device configuration, start, stop, status query and enumeration. These IOCTLs are not part of any public uAPI header and have no known in-tree or out-of-tree users. Device lifecycle is already managed via sysfs. The ioctl interface also increases the attack surface and is the subject of a number of bug reports. Remove the character device, the IOCTL definitions, and the related data structures (adf_dev_status_info, adf_user_cfg_key_val, adf_user_cfg_section, adf_user_cfg_ctl_data). Drop the now-unused adf_cfg_user.h header and strip adf_ctl_drv.c down to the minimal module_init/module_exit hooks for workqueue, AER, and crypto/compression algorithm registration. Clean up leftover dead code that was only reachable from the removed IOCTL paths: adf_cfg_del_all(), adf_devmgr_verify_id(), adf_devmgr_get_num_dev(), adf_devmgr_get_dev_by_id(), adf_get_vf_real_id() and the unused ADF_CFG macros. Additionally, drop the entry associated to QAT IOCTLs in ioctl-number.rst.
